ACCIDENTS NEWS

  • On April 5 at 8:52 p.m., the Leopold Fire Department responded to a water rescue on County Road 402—assisted by teams from Woodland Fire Protection District, North Bollinger County Fire Protection District and the Cape Girardeau Fire Department Regional HSRT Technical Rescue Team—to rescue two people trapped in the water without injury.  Fox 23
  • Cape Girardeau police said 35-year-old Ashley G. Braxton died in a single-vehicle crash on Bloomfield Rd on April 4 when her blue 2020 GMC Acadia left the road and struck a mailbox and a tree in front of a home around 10:58 a.m.  KFVS12
  • A Jackson Fire Rescue team saved a Jackson resident when his stalled vehicle began floating on a flooded low-water bridge, with Captain Justin Farrar entering the water with a life vest to rescue him — officials remind drivers to avoid flooded roads.  Fox 23

CRIME NEWS

  • On April 6 at 2:13 p.m., the Ripley County Sheriff’s Office was called to a home seven miles west of Doniphan where a barricaded man armed with a knife was first observed and later, around 5:33 p.m., advanced toward officers—officers fired and he was pronounced dead at the scene.  Fox 23

GOVERNMENT NEWS

  • Bridgett Kielhofner was appointed as Assistant Finance Director for Cape Girardeau effective April 7—she will support Finance Director Lisa Mills and the Finance Department. City Manager Kenneth Haskin praised her strong background in financial analysis, budgeting, and real estate for strengthening the city's finance team.  Fox 23
  • Cape Girardeau Mayor Stacy Kinder, New Madrid Mayor Nick White and Caruthersville Mayor Sue Grantham met Monday at 2 p.m.—the mayors discussed flooding issues, road closures and water rescues as part of a regional effort to monitor Mississippi River levels and address stormwater concerns.  Fox 23
  • Storms and flooding caused a 24-inch sewer main to break near the dry docks over the weekend, and repairs are delayed because high water levels have prevented work from starting. Alliance Water Resources said work will begin Thursday—only a temporary road closure is expected and residents' sewer service will not be affected—while about 20 feet of pipe may need replacement at an estimated cost of $7,500.  Fox 23
